Ingredients You’ll Need

Get ready to gather some simple yet flavorful ingredients that come together to create a masterpiece! The star of the show is undoubtedly the pistachio cream, which brings a rich, nutty sweetness to the mix. Let’s check out what else you’ll need for these scrumptious bars:

– 9 tbsp (134g) salted butter
– 1/2 cup (125g) brown sugar, light or dark
– 1/4 cup (40g) granulated sugar
– 1 egg, at room temperature
– 1 tbsp (15g) heavy cream, at room temperature
– 1 1/2 tsp (8g) vanilla extract
– 1 1/4 cup + 2 tbsp (190g) all-purpose flour
– 1/2 tsp (3g) baking soda
– 1/2 tsp (2g) baking powder
– 1/4 tsp (1g) salt
– 3/4 cup (120g) semi-sweet chocolate chips
– 3 cups (300g) kataifi (shredded phyllo dough)
– 1 cup (300g) pistachio cream/butter
– 2 tbsp (28g) salted butter
– 2 cups (475ml) heavy cream
– 1 cup (170g) semi-sweet chocolate chips
– Chopped pistachios, for garnishing

How to Make Brown Butter Dubai Pistachio Chocolate Chip Cookie Bars 🍪

Ready to dive into this exciting baking adventure? Follow these easy steps to create your own batch of deliciousness:

Step 1: Preheat and Prepare

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ease an 8×8” baking pan with butter, then line it with parchment paper, making sure to leave some overhang for easy removal. Set aside that beauty!

Step 2: Brown the Butter

In a saucepan over medium-high heat, melt the salted butter. Stir frequently until it turns a lovely golden brown and smells nutty—about 5 minutes. Remove it from the heat and pour into a large mixing bowl, allowing it to cool slightly.

Step 3: Mix the Dry Ingredients

In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, baking powder, and salt. Set it aside for later.

Step 4: Combine the Sugars and Egg

Once the brown butter has cooled, whisk in both sugars until combined. Then, crack in the egg and whisk until the mixture lightens in color and is well blended.

Step 5: Add Cream and Vanilla

Pour in the heavy cream and vanilla extract, whisking until everything is beautifully combined.

Step 6: Fold in Dry Ingredients

Gently add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ture and fold until everything is incorporated.

Step 7: Chocolate Chip Bliss

Fold in the semi-sweet chocolate chips until evenly distributed throughout the dough.

Step 8: Bake the Base

Scoop the dough into your prepared baking pan and spread it out evenly. Bake at 350°F for 22-27 minutes, until lightly golden on top. Allow to cool while you prepare for the next stages.

Step 9: Toast the Kataifi

In a large pan over medium heat, melt the remaining 2 tbsp of butter. Add the shredded kataifi and toast until golden and crispy, stirring frequently. Transfer to a bowl and let it cool. Mix the toasted kataifi with the pistachio cream until well combined.

Step 10: Create the Ganache

Place the chocolate chips in a large bowl. Heat the heavy cream in a small saucepan until just boiling. Pour the hot cream over the chocolate chips, letting it sit for 5 minutes before stirring until smooth.

Step 11: Layer It Up

Press the pistachio filling over the cooled cookie layer evenly. Pour the silky chocolate ganache over the pistachio layer, spreading it out evenly. Top with chopped pistachios for that extra crunch!

Step 12: Chill and Cut

Place the cookie bars in the fridge to set for at least 1 hour. Once set, cut into 16 delicious squares and enjoy!

Pro Tips for Making Brown Butter Dubai Pistachio Chocolate Chip Cookie Bars 🍪

Don’t Rush the Browning: Keep an eye on the butter while browning, as it can go from perfect to burnt in seconds!
Room Temperature Ingredients: Ensure your eggs and cream are at room temperature for a smoother batter.
Use High-Quality Chocolate: Opt for good quality chocolate for the ganache for a truly decadent finish.
Allow to Cool: Resist the temptation to cut the bars too soon! Letting them chill helps the layers set nicely.

Make Ahead and Storage

Storing Leftovers

To store any leftovers, simply cover the bars with plastic wrap or keep them in an airtight container. They’ll stay fresh in the fridge for up to a week!

Freezing

Yes! You can freeze these cookie bars by wrapping them tightly in plastic wrap and then placing them in an airtight container. They’ll keep well for up to 3 months.

Reheating

If you’d like to serve them warm, pop them in the microwave for a few seconds or enjoy them chilled for a refreshing treat!
